ELOUISE DAVIS WINSLETT

Elouise Davis Winslett, 87, of Panama City, passed away Monday, January 13, 2014. She was born on March 14, 1926 in Noma, Florida and had been a resident of Panama City since 1958. She was a retired purchasing agent for Naval Coastal Systems Station. She was a member of Northside Baptist Church. She was preceded in death by her husband, Arnold Junior Winslett; daughter, Gloria Jean Winslett; and two sisters, Valerie Tate and Betty Joyce Lage. She is survived by her two sons, Thomas Winslett and wife Toni of Loganville, GA, David Winslett of Panama City; two grandchildren, Brett Thomas Winslett, Heather Winslett Beverly and husband Mark; one great grandson, Case Beverly; one sister, Joann Rhodes of Panama City; and several nieces and nephews. Funeral services will be held at 11 a.m. on Thursday in the Wilson Funeral Home Chapel with Dr. Jerry Moore and Rev. Luther Stanford officiating. Interment will follow in Evergreen Memorial Gardens. The family will receive friends at the funeral home on Thursday from 10 – 11 a.m. prior to the service. Those desiring may make memorial donations to Northside Baptist Church, 530 Airport Road, Panama City, FL 32405 in memory of Elouise Winslett.
